KiCON US

One thing that did go well was my third attempt at a KiCAD workbench for FreeCAD. I tried this once with KiCadStepUp as the basis but as it was too monolithic I had trouble hooking into it to use as an API. My second attempt used the KiCADs SWIG bindings. This went decently well but a conversation with Wayne, project lead for KiCAD I figured I should wait for KiCAD v9 and use its new long term API. I started this project late 2024 and spent most of January hammering on a prototype that I was satisfied with. This became KiConnect

Barback V2: The Cleanening

Barback V2 design files have finally been cleaned up! The project was plagued with tons of DAG errors and cyclical dependencies. With burnout from the big push last November, the hardware basically working, the firmware still needing a lot of attention, and being actively asked to pour at events… Time for this part of the project was hard to find. But with that last part, actively pouring drinks, we’ve come to find many short comings in the current design.

Interlocking Storage Bins in FreeCAD

FreeCAD Preview of Interlocking Boxes

Needing some storage bins for the garage I came up with the idea for self-aligning stackable bins. Cut from 3/4" ply, the trick is the 45deg on the bottom panel and inside edges. My first attempt was a quick hand drawing and somewhere along the way I ended up with misaligned pieces. So in order to ensure my dimensions made sense I figured I’d FreeCAD it up. It’s pretty simple but still parametric, able to adjust for material thickness and inner dimensions. Plus, I figured if the design did work out (so far it’s looking good!) I could CNC batches of them, that would only need the 45def chamfers routed and final assembly. Would also update to include hand holds.
